2025年最新数据库系统工程师考试专项练习题集.docxVIP

  • 0
  • 0
  • 约5.53千字
  • 约 11页
  • 2026-01-23 发布于山西
  • 举报

2025年最新数据库系统工程师考试专项练习题集.docx

2025年最新数据库系统工程师考试专项练习题集

考试时间:______分钟总分:______分姓名:______

一、选择题(每题2分,共30分)

1.下列关于关系模型中候选键的描述,错误的是()。

A.候选键可以唯一标识关系中的每一个元组

B.候选键中的属性都是非主属性

C.一个关系可以有多个候选键

D.候选键的属性不能取空值

2.SQL语句中使用`GROUPBY`子句进行分组查询时,若要确保分组结果的唯一性,应使用哪个函数?()

A.`AVG()`

B.`COUNT()`

C.`SUM()`

D.`DISTINCT`

3.在数据库并发控制中,读-写冲突和写-写冲突的根本原因在于()。

A.数据不一致

B.事务隔离级别设置不当

C.多个事务同时访问同一数据项

D.锁机制失效

4.以下哪种索引结构通常适用于频繁进行范围查询的数据?()

A.B+树索引

B.哈希索引

C.全文索引

D.位图索引

5.在SQLServer中,用于声明事务的语句是()。

A.`BEGINTABLE`

B.`STARTTRANSACTION`

C.`COMMITWORK`

D.`BEGINSEQUENCE`

6.以下关于数据库备份的描述,错误的是()。

A.冷备份是指关闭数据库后对数据进行完整拷贝

B.暖备份是指数据库运行时进行的备份

C.日志备份不能恢复到某一特定时刻的数据状态

D.备份策略应考虑恢复时间点(RTO)和恢复点目标(RPO)

7.读取未提交(ReadUncommitted)事务隔离级别的主要问题是()。

A.脏读

B.不可重复读

C.幻读

D.以上都是

8.NoSQL数据库的主要优势之一是()。

A.强一致性

B.简单的数据模型

C.支持复杂的SQL查询

D.高昂的运维成本

9.在分布式数据库系统中,实现数据一致性的常用方法是()。

A.两阶段提交协议

B.三阶段提交协议

C.可靠消息传递

D.以上都是

10.下列哪种技术主要用于提高数据库的读取性能?()

A.数据分区

B.索引优化

C.缓存(Cache)

D.异步写入

11.数据库索引通常是创建在()上。

A.数据文件

B.事务日志文件

C.数据字典

D.索引文件

12.下列关于数据库安全性的描述,错误的是()。

A.数据加密可以保护数据在存储和传输过程中的安全

B.角色基于访问控制(RBAC)是一种常用的权限管理模型

C.审计日志可以用于追踪用户行为,但无法防止未授权访问

D.SQL注入是一种常见的数据库安全漏洞

13.云数据库服务(如AWSRDS)通常提供的最高可用性方案是()。

A.单节点部署

B.主从复制

C.多可用区部署

D.磁盘镜像

14.下列哪种数据库模型最适合存储结构化数据?()

A.关系模型

B.层次模型

C.网状模型

D.对象模型

15.数据库性能分析中,分析执行计划(ExecutionPlan)的主要目的是()。

A.查看SQL语句是否被优化

B.确定查询涉及哪些表和索引

C.评估查询的响应时间

D.以上都是

二、填空题(每空2分,共20分)

1.关系模型中,用于描述实体之间联系的模型是________模型。

2.SQL语言中,用于删除表结构的语句是________。

3.数据库事务的四个基本特性通常简称为________、一致性、隔离性和持久性。

4.索引的主要目的是提高数据库的________效率和________效率。

5.在数据库设计中,将关系模式分解为多个关系模式,以消除冗余和修改异常的过程称为________。

6.用于存储数据库系统自身运行所需的数据和信息的数据库称为________。

7.NoSQL数据库中的键值存储(Key-ValueStore)模型通常采用________式数据结构来存储数据。

8.分布式数据库系统中,实现数据分片(Partitioning)的主要目的是提高

文档评论(0)

1亿VIP精品文档

相关文档